Accelerate
Modern treadmills have been designed to closely replicate the effort required to run in the outdoors. The treadmills are adjustable in speed and incline, so you can simulate running on a variety of types of terrain. For new runners it is recommended to start with a slow pace and a low slope to increase endurance. As your fitness improves you can increase the incline as well as your speed to burn more calories.
Most home treadmills are limited to a maximum speed of 12 miles per hour. This is usually sufficient for most people, but some athletes prefer faster speeds to increase their calories-burning and muscle-building efforts. Commercial gyms also have treadmills that achieve speeds of up to 15 mph and some even have inclines up to 30 percent.
Warm your legs and feet before you start the incline. You can cause injury when you begin an incline workout without warming up your feet and legs. Begin with a moderate slope, like 1 or 2 percent, and gradually increase it as time passes.
A good incline for walking for those who are new to walking is 3 or 4 percent and you should aim to walk for 20-30 minutes at this level every time you go out. The more you walk on this incline the greater the impact of burning calories and the more strong your legs will get. It's also a great way to tone and burn off fat your lower body.

Incline
Treadmills are designed to resemble the effort required to run outdoors. The incline feature of a treadmill can be used to spice up your exercises. Walking and running on an incline will engage more muscles, like the glutes and hamstrings, and burn more calories. This will also improve your V02 max, which is the amount of oxygen you absorb and then transfer to your muscles.
